Hey LL,
I looked over some of your past posts, so I would be able to make a more informed response, given that you currently only have two CCs.
With the increase in your Fico scores, you should be approved.
As you may have noticed, it is the weekend, and if you are not immediately approved, the skeleton crew they have working on weekends, might not have the time to review your application and get it approved quickly & in a TIMELY manner.
My recommendation is for you to consider applying next week. This way they have a full staff of loan officers and under writers to review your application and "appeal" known as a Recon, reconsideration. In the message you would address their answers as to why you were denied, and why they should approve you. You obviously have enough reasons and information to address that you are a safe and reliable risk on their part.
I have successfully conducted recons with both Navy & Pen Fed, and find the effort to be more easily resolved and in a timely manner during the work week.
